1
0
mirror of synced 2024-12-15 15:46:02 +03:00
doctrine2/manual/docs/Coding standards - Naming Conventions - Functions and methods.php

22 lines
1.0 KiB
PHP
Raw Normal View History

2007-04-14 01:49:11 +04:00
* Function names may only contain alphanumeric characters. Underscores are not permitted. Numbers are permitted in function names but are discouraged.
2007-04-14 01:49:11 +04:00
* Function names must always start with a lowercase letter. When a function name consists of more than one word, the first letter of each new word must be capitalized. This is commonly called the "studlyCaps" or "camelCaps" method.
2007-04-14 01:49:11 +04:00
* Verbosity is encouraged. Function names should be as verbose as is practical to enhance the understandability of code.
2007-04-14 01:49:11 +04:00
* For object-oriented programming, accessors for objects should always be prefixed with either "get" or "set". This applies to all classes except for Doctrine_Record which has some accessor methods prefixed with 'obtain' and 'assign'. The reason
2007-04-14 01:49:11 +04:00
for this is that since all user defined ActiveRecords inherit Doctrine_Record, it should populate the get / set namespace as little as possible.
* Functions in the global scope ("floating functions") are NOT permmitted. All static functions should be wrapped in a static class.
2007-04-14 01:49:11 +04:00